Account recovery, consent-banner edition. If you get locked out of the Mossbridge rollout console mid-deploy (happens more than you'd think — the session store resets when the banner config flips regions), don't panic and don't re-trigger the rollout. Pause the flag in Fernwick first, then recover your account through the break-glass flow. It'll ask for the team recovery phrase before letting you back in. Type the passphrase below exactly as written.

unlock words, taguf-yafop: quenwyn-druox

Handover: the Querida planner regression from build 318 causes full scans on joins with filtered subqueries. Workaround for support: advise customers to add an explicit index hint until the patch ships. Fix is merged to staging, rollout pending. Escalations on this issue should be routed to the engineer named below.

account owner for bawip-tahag: Raleth Quenok

// WARNING: Do not lower this threshold without reading ticket PLANNER-4412.
// After the Quarrel 2.9 upgrade, the query planner began choosing a nested-loop
// join for mid-cardinality lookups on the Ledgerby tenant shards, regressing p95
// latency by roughly 6x. This constant forces the hash-join path whenever the
// estimated row count exceeds it. The value was derived from replaying the
// Marlowe bench suite against three shard profiles. The validated planner build
// token is recorded on the next line.

pipeline stamp: htk31_f769b577b3028a4e9958e5bb8d1259a